PURPOSE OF THE JOB: To design, implement engineering standards and procedures, and responsible for overall management of the engineering functions within the Impala operations. The role encompasses the improvement of efficiencies and sustainability of processes whilst minimising operational and business risks and reducing waste. M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S AND REQUIREMENTS: Engineering Degree or NQF Level 7 equivalent is essential Government Certificate of Competency Mines of works in Electrical or Mechanical Engineering is essential (2.13.1) Registration with Engineering Council of South Africa (ECSA) is desirable Management/Leadership Development Programme (MMDP/SMDP) is essential 5 - 7 years operational experience, which 2 years are inclusive of a recognised junior engineering program training is essential 3 - 5 years managerial experience within the Hard Rock Mining environment is essential 3 - 5 years Project Management experience is essential COMPETENCIES: Electrical and Mechanical engineering theory General management methodologies and principles Legal knowledge related to the mining industry Financial methodologies and principles (e.g. IRR assessments) Strategic management principles Operational knowledge related to the mining industry Awareness of safety regulations and practices within mining operations Strategic leadership Data analysis skills KEY PERFORMANCE AREAS: Manage the effective short-, medium- and long-term planning of all engineering related activities and operations in support of Implats as an effective business (inclusive of utilities, technical services, and transport). Ensure engineering compliance with statutory requirements (business, safety, and risk management). Ensure overall effectiveness, maximum availability of equipment and engineering integrity (upholding of professional engineering standards). Introduce new technology to ensure improved performance of equipment or infrastructure which are outdated. Develop engineers for succession planning purposes and to ensure a pool of engineering talent is available for strategic employment purposes. Effectively guide engineering staff in providing a quality professional service to Implats business units. Ensure that capital and working costs are effectively managed with business plan parameters. Ensure that there is a smooth co-ordination between the logistic Manager shaft and the vertical and horizontal operations engineers Ensure that there is synergy between mining and engineering department Our people set us apart and make us a winning team we are excited to have someone new join our ranks.
